Wealth chief Valerie Murray exits Provident Financial (NYSE: PFS) with payout

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Provident Financial Services, Inc. disclosed that Valerie O. Murray, President of Beacon Trust Company and Executive Vice President and Chief Wealth Management Officer of Provident Bank, has decided to leave the organization, with her resignation effective May 22, 2026.
Under a Separation Agreement and General Release, she will go on paid “garden leave” from March 27, 2026 through May 22, 2026, moving to a non-executive role while continuing to receive salary and benefits. Subject to customary conditions, including a full release of claims, she will receive a lump-sum payment of $1,200,000, less taxes. The company states her resignation is not related to any disagreement over operations, policies or practices.
